Description We’re looking for a hands‑on part‑time maintenance technician to join our team working 20-25 hours per week. You’ll make sure our facilities are operating efficiently, regularly inspect our building for any damage, and conduct routine maintenance on our equipment to keep it running smoothly, as well as handling snow plowing and snow removal.
The ideal person for this job is a reliable team player and a problem solver who has some prior maintenance experience. If this position sounds like a good fit for you, reach out to us today!
Responsibilities
General community maintenance/curb appeal
Daily grounds‑keeping and cleanup
Mowing, trimming, and landscaping
Snow removal, salting, sanding
Light painting and carpentry work
Minor plumbing and electrical repairs
Monthly vehicle and equipment inspections & reporting
Equipment maintenance
On‑call for after‑hours emergencies
Inspect the building for any structural damage to windows, doors, walls, and perform necessary repairs
Take additional maintenance requests as assigned
Establish and implement preventative maintenance protocols to keep equipment operations smooth and eliminate safety risks
Record when any equipment was serviced and repairs were made
Qualifications
Must have knowledge of the proper use of power and hand tools
Must have experience with and knowledge of the proper use of landscaping and plowing equipment
Experience in structural elements, framing, dry‑wall installation, flooring, and painting preferred
Plumbing, mechanical, electrical, and HVAC experience is helpful
Must have knowledge of safety procedures and be willing to work safely
Must possess the ability to lift and carry up to 50 pounds
Must be able and willing to work independently under the direction of the community manager
Must have a valid driver’s license with no major violations
Must be willing to work a flexible schedule and be on‑call for evening and weekend emergencies
Must undergo a standard background check
At least 2 years of maintenance experience
Stellar communication skills, attention to detail, and work ethic
Must have graduated from high school/received GED or equivalent
Compensation $22 - $23 hourly
